使用Visual FoxPro (VF):
```vb
s = 0
FOR i = 1 TO 1000
s = s + (1 / (2 * i - 1)) * (-1)^(i - 1)
NEXT
s = s * 4
? "兀约等于", s
```
使用Fortran:
```fortran
PROGRAM CalculatePi
IMPLICIT NONE
INTEGER :: i
REAL :: pi, sumsum = 0.0
DO i = 1, 1000000
sumsum = sumsum + 4.0 / (2 * i - 1)2 END DO pi = sqrt(6 * sumsum) PRINT *, "The value of pi is: ", pi END PROGRAM CalculatePi ``` 使用Python
```python
import math
def calculate_pi(n):
pi = 0
for i in range(n):
pi += (-1) i / (2 * i + 1)
return 4 * pi
print("π ≈", calculate_pi(10000))
print("π =", math.pi)
```
这些程序分别使用VF、Fortran和Python编程语言,通过不同的数学公式和算法来计算π的近似值。你可以根据自己的需求和熟悉程度选择合适的编程语言和程序进行尝试。